I have installed samba server on RED-HAT-4, After sharing a folder and making the configuration in samba.conf file i can see it on my machine in GUI, but i can't access it on windows network, what is the problem?
I have made the following configuration.
Workgroup=microhome
[kumar]
comment = testshare
guest ok = yes
path = /home/guru/songs
browseable = yes
writeable = yes
encrypt passwords = yes
smb passwd file = /etc/samba/smbpasswd
I can access those files using smbclient, but i was unable to access it in windows network, my friend said i have to disable selinux i have also done it but it still does not works.
i have also disabled iptables in my machine, but still i cant access it on windows network.
but the same config works in my friends machine, we have tried it for more than some 40 times. please help..
